#e78661 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e78661 is composed of 90.6% red, 52.5% green and 38%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 42% magenta, 58% yellow and 9.4% black. It has a hue angle of 16.6 degrees, a saturation of 73.6% and a lightness of 64.3%. #e78661 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ffc2 with #cf0d00. Closest websafe color is: #ff9966.

#e78661 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e78661 has RGB values of R:231, G:134, B:97 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.42, Y:0.58,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 15173217.
